#334cb9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#334cb9 is composed of 20% red, 29.8%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.4% cyan, 58.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 228.8 degrees, a saturation of 56.8% and a lightness of 46.3%. #334cb9 color hex could be obtained by blending #6698ff with #000073.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#334cb9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0f2f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#334cb9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737479 is the less saturated color, while #0630e6 is the most saturated one.
